Nestled amidst the picturesque Blue Ridge Mountains, Burnsville, North Carolina, is a hidden gem that captivates visitors with its natural beauty, rich history, and vibrant community life. Among the many unique neighborhoods that contribute to the town’s charm, the Celo community stands out as a testament to sustainable living, communal values, and a deep connection with nature.
One of the defining features of Burnsville is its proximity to the stunning landscapes of the Blue Ridge Mountains. The Celo community, situated just a short drive away, is enveloped by the lush forests and rolling hills, providing residents with a breathtaking backdrop for their daily lives. Residents and visitors alike can explore the numerous hiking trails, enjoy the mesmerizing views, and embrace a lifestyle that is deeply intertwined with the natural environment.
The Celo community is renowned for its commitment to sustainability and environmental stewardship. Founded in the 1930s, this intentional community has embraced a way of life that prioritizes harmony with nature. From organic farming practices to eco-friendly architecture, Celo exemplifies a dedication to minimizing ecological impact while fostering a sense of communal responsibility.
At the heart of Celo’s sustainable ethos is its thriving organic farming community. Residents actively engage in cultivating crops, practicing permaculture, and supporting local agriculture. The community’s commitment to organic farming not only ensures access to fresh, locally sourced produce but also promotes a healthier and more sustainable lifestyle.
What sets the Celo community apart is its emphasis on communal living and shared values. Residents come together to celebrate traditions, organize events, and participate in decision-making processes. This sense of community fosters strong social bonds and a supportive environment that extends beyond individual households.
Celo is home to educational initiatives that align with the community’s values. The Arthur Morgan School, a progressive, co-educational boarding school, provides an alternative education experience that emphasizes community involvement, creativity, and a connection with nature. This commitment to holistic education reflects Celo’s dedication to nurturing well-rounded individuals who are conscious of their impact on the world.
